Application for Registration of a Trade-mark.

(No. 373.)
Patent Office,
Wellington, 10th December, 1891.
NOTICE is hereby given that GEORGE GLEDHILL, of Rutland Street, Auckland, New Zealand, Mineral-water Manufacturer, has applied to register, under “The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ks Act, 1889,” the trade-mark of which the following is a representation :—

[Image: Horse with 'GG' superimposed]

Nature of the Articles to which it is intended such Trade-mark shall apply.
Mineral and aerated waters, natural and artificial, including ginger-beer.

Class of Goods in connection with which the Applicant desires the Trade-mark to be registered.
Class No. 44.

Any person may, within two months of the date of this Gazette, give notice, in duplicate, at this office, of opposition to the registration of the trade-mark. A fee of £1 is payable with such notice.

C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Registrar of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ks.

Application for Registration of a Trade-mark.

(No. 374.)
Patent Office,
Wellington, 10th December, 1891.
NOTICE is hereby given that CHARLES WILLIAM HAWKINS, Medical Herbalist, of 101, George Street, Dunedin, New Zealand, has applied to register, under “The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ks Act, 1889,” the trade-mark of which the following is a description :—
The words

BLACK CROSS.

Nature of the Articles to which it is intended such Trade-mark shall apply.
Medicated articles in pharmacy.

Class of Goods in connection with which the Applicant desires the Trade-mark to be registered.
Class No. 3.

Any person may, within two months of the date of this Gazette, give notice, in duplicate, at this office, of opposition to the registration of the trade-mark. A fee of £1 is payable with such notice.

C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Registrar of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ks.

Application for Registration of a Trade-mark.

(No. 375.)
Patent Office,
Wellington, 10th December, 1891.
NOTICE is hereby given that F. B. BENGER AND COMPANY (LIMITED), of Strangeways, Manchester, Lancashire, England, Manufacturing Chemists, have applied to register, under “The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ks Act, 1889,” the trade-mark of which the following is a description :—
The words

BENGER’S FOOD.

The applicants claim that this trade-mark has been in use by them and their predecessors in business since December, 1881.

Nature of the Article to which it is intended such Trade-mark shall apply.
A food for infants and invalids.

Class of Goods in connection with which the Applicants desire the Trade-mark to be registered.
Class No. 42.

Any person may, within two months of the date of this Gazette, give notice, in duplicate, at this office, of opposition to the registration of the trade-mark. A fee of £1 is payable with such notice.

C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Registrar of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ks.

Application for Registration of a Trade-mark.

(No. 377.)
Patent Office,
Wellington, 10th December, 1891.
NOTICE is hereby given that HOWARD OSBORNE, of Lambton Quay, Wellington, New Zealand, Trunk-maker, has applied to register, under “The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ks Act, 1889,” the trade-mark of which the following is a representation :—

[Image: Lion with banner reading 'TRADE MARK']

The applicant disclaims the right to the exclusive use of the words “Trade Mark.”

Nature of the Articles to which it is intended such Trade-mark shall apply.
Bags, portmanteaux, belts, purses, ladies’ bags, trunks, and valises.

Class of Goods in connection with which the Applicant desires the Trade-mark to be registered.
Class No. 37.

Any person may, within two months of the date of this Gazette, give notice, in duplicate, at this office, of opposition to the registration of the trade-mark. A fee of £1 is payable with such notice.

C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Registrar of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ks.

Application for Registration of a Trade-mark.

(No. 378.)
Patent Office,
Wellington, 10th December, 1891.
NOTICE is hereby given that WILLIAM CHARLES LANGSTONE, of Greytown, Wellington, New Zealand, Veterinary Surgeon, has applied to register, under “The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ks Act, 1889,” the trade-mark of which the following is a representation :—

[Image: Boxed trade mark with star, letters W.C.L., sheep, and text 'VERMIFUGE Intestinal & Bronchial Parasites']

The applicant claims, as the essential particulars of the above represented trade-mark, the representation of a sheep, above which is a star and the letters W. C. L., and on the right and left-hand side of which are the letters V. and S. respectively, and disclaims any right to the exclusive use of the words “Trade Mark,” “Vermifuge,” and “Intestinal and Bronchial Parasites.”

Nature of the Articles to which it is intended such Trade-mark shall apply.
A vermifuge remedy for intestinal and bronchial parasites in sheep.

Class of Goods in connection with which the Applicant desires the Trade-mark to be registered.
Class No. 2.

Any person may, within two months of the date of this Gazette, give notice, in duplicate, at this office, of opposition to the registration of the trade-mark. A fee of £1 is payable with such notice.

C. J. A. HASELDEN,
Registrar of Patents, Designs, and Trade-marks.
